In one way, the name was apt: Ulvaeus and F\u00e4ltskog would marry in 1971, and Andersson and Lyngstad followed suit in \u201978. But Festfolk struggled to bring the party, with only one modest hit (1972\u2019s \u201cPeople Need Love\u201d) getting attention.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Everything changed when the band entered&nbsp;Melodifestivalen (which, as a festival for melodic sound, is exactly what it sounds like) in an attempt to represent&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.britannica.com\/place\/Sweden\">Sweden<\/a>&nbsp;at&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.britannica.com\/art\/Eurovision-Song-Contest\">Eurovision<\/a>&nbsp;1973. After winning third place, they swiftly renamed themselves ABBA\u2014after the first letter of each performer\u2019s first name\u2014and started working on a song for next year\u2019s competition.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Their second attempt proved more successful. ABBA won Melodifestivalen 1974 with a hit that had a historical twist: \u201cWaterloo,\u201d which likened the end of a romantic relationship to the epic defeat of Emperor&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.britannica.com\/biography\/Napoleon-I\">Napoleon<\/a>. (Ouch.) That sent them to the \u201cOlympics of song\u201d\u2014Eurovision, held that year in Brighton, England. Despite tough competition from British entrant&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.britannica.com\/biography\/Olivia-Newton-John\">Olivia Newton-John<\/a>, ABBA\u2019s spangly outfits and wild theatricality (including their conductor appearing in full Napoleonic regalia) stole the show. It was Sweden\u2019s first Eurovision win and is one of the most famous performances in the contest\u2019s history.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>What comes after winning Eurovision? For ABBA, the answer was total world domination. \u201cWaterloo\u201d topped charts across Europe, setting the stage for a record-breaking career that included number-one hits in dozens of countries.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Just don\u2019t learn your history lessons from ABBA. \u201cAt Waterloo, Napoleon did surrender\u201d is a catchy lyric, but not quite accurate.
